What is a Wi-Fi Router?
A Wi-Fi router is a device that transmits data wirelessly, enabling multiple devices to connect to a single internet source. Routers can function as both a modem and a wireless access point (WAP), providing internet connectivity and creating local area networks (LANs).
Why Connect Two Routers Wirelessly?
Extended Coverage: In larger homes or offices, a single router might not suffice to provide optimal internet coverage. Adding a second router can help eliminate dead zones and improve connectivity in remote areas.
Improved Performance: By distributing the load between two routers, you can reduce congestion and enhance the overall speed and performance of your network.
Increased Connections: If you have multiple devices that require internet access—smart TVs, gaming consoles, computers, and mobile devices—connecting an additional router can support more simultaneous connections without sacrificing speed.

Step-by-Step Guide to Connect Two Wi-Fi Routers Wirelessly
Now that you’re familiar with the basics and have your equipment ready, let’s go through the step-by-step process of connecting two Wi-Fi routers wirelessly.
Step 1: Initial Setup of the Primary Router
- Connect your primary router to your internet source (modem) via Ethernet cable.
- Power on the router and connect a computer or a laptop to the router’s network (either wired or wirelessly).
- Open a web browser and enter the router’s IP address (usually something like 192.168.1.1 or 192.168.0.1) to access the admin panel.
- Log in with the default username and password (found on the router’s label or in the user manual).
- Configure your network settings—set your Wi-Fi name (SSID) and password, and ensure to save all changes.
Step 2: Configuring the Secondary Router
- Power on the secondary router and connect it to your computer or laptop using an Ethernet cable (temporary connection).
- Access the secondary router’s admin panel using its IP address.
- Reset the router to its factory settings (if you’re unsure of the settings).
- Change the IP address of the second router to avoid conflicts with the primary router. For example, if the primary router’s IP is 192.168.1.1, set the secondary router’s IP to 192.168.1.2.
- Disable the DHCP (Dynamic Host Configuration Protocol) server on the secondary router. This ensures that the primary router manages IP addresses on the network.
Step 3: Establishing Wireless Connection Between Routers
- Navigate back to the primary router’s settings and enable the option for Wi-Fi bridging or repeating. This feature may be found under the wireless settings.
- Scan for available networks to find the SSID of the secondary router.
- Connect to the secondary router’s network and enter its password when prompted.
- On the secondary router, search for the wireless settings and locate the option for WDS (Wireless Distribution System) or similar. Enable it and enter the SSID and password of the primary router.
- After configuring the settings, save the changes and reboot both routers.
Step 4: Testing the Connection
Once the routers are rebooted, disconnect the Ethernet cable from the secondary router. You should now be able to access the internet wirelessly through both routers. Test your connection by connecting to the secondary router with a device and checking if you can browse the internet seamlessly.
Troubleshooting Common Issues
Even with careful configuration, issues may arise. Here are some common problems and solutions:
Signal Strength Issues
If you find that the signal is weak in certain areas, consider repositioning the secondary router to a more central location or adjusting its antennas (if available) for optimal reception.
Connection Drops
If your connection frequently drops, ensure both routers are updated to the latest firmware version. You might also want to check for interference from other electronic devices.
IP Address Conflicts
If you experience network problems, check the IP addresses of both routers to ensure they are appropriately configured without conflicts.
Best Practices and Considerations
Placement of Routers: Position the primary router in a central location, and place the secondary router at a distance where you still receive good signal strength.
Security Settings: Ensure both routers use strong, unique passwords to prevent unauthorized access. Enable WPA3 encryption if available.
Regular Maintenance: Periodically check and update the firmware of both routers, and review your network settings to ensure optimal performance.
Use Quality Equipment: Quality routers can positively affect your overall network performance. Research models that are well-reviewed for stability and speed.

Will connecting two routers wirelessly slow down my internet speed?
Connecting two routers wirelessly can potentially affect internet speed, particularly if using older wireless standards or poor signal quality. When data is transmitted between routers wirelessly, the bandwidth is shared, which can lead to slower speeds if many devices are connected simultaneously.
To mitigate speed loss, consider using dual-band routers that can operate on both 2.4 GHz and 5 GHz bands. This allows for managing devices better, as high-bandwidth applications can be assigned to the 5 GHz band while the 2.4 GHz band is reserved for devices that require a longer range but do not require as much speed.
How can I secure the connection between the two routers?
Securing the connection between two routers wirelessly is essential to prevent unauthorized access to your network. Start by ensuring both routers have strong, unique passwords for their networks. Employing WPA3 encryption, if available, provides an added layer of security.
Additionally, disable features such as WPS (Wi-Fi Protected Setup), which can be vulnerable to brute-force attacks. It’s also vital to regularly update the firmware of both routers to patch any security vulnerabilities, providing better overall protection against potential threats.
